Возвращает ближайшее целое число, большее или равное аргументу.
Math.ceil (number)
number - любое числовое выражение.
// Показывает значение 46 document.write (" ceil 45.95 - " + Math.ceil (45.95)) // Показывает значение -45 document.write ("The Ceil -45.95 - " + Math.ceil (-45.95))
Возвращает символ из строки.
StringName.charAt (index)
StringName - любая строка или свойство существующего объекта.
Индекс - любое целое число от 0 до stringName.length - 1, или собственности существующего объекта(цели).
Знаки в строке индексированы слева направо. Индекс первого символа - 0, последнего символа - stringName.length - 1. Если index находится вне диапазона, то JavaScript возвращает пустую строку.
"+" символ в индексе 1 - " + anyString.charAt (1)) document.write ("
"+" символ в индексе 2 - " + anyString.charAt (2)) document.write ("
"+" символ в индексе 3 - " + anyString.charAt (3)) document.write ("
"+" символ в индексе 4 - " + anyString.charAt (4))
Элемент формы, который пользователь устанавливает в состоянии on или off посредством щелчка левой кнопкой миши.
Чтобы определить объект checkbox, используйте стандарт HTML синтаксис с использованием обработчика событий onClick:
VALUE = "checkboxValue" определяет значение, которая возвращена серверу, когда checkbox выбран, и форма подчинена. Это значение по умолчанию on. Вы можете обращаться к этому значению, используя свойство значения.
CHECKED определяет состояние флажка. Вы можете обращаться к этому значению, используя свойство defaultChecked.
TextToDisplay определяет значение, которое показано на экране.
Использование свойству объекта и методы checkbox:
1. CheckboxName.propertyName 2. CheckboxName.methodName (parameters) 3. FormName.elements [index] .propertyName 4. formName.elements[index].methodName(parameters)CheckboxName - значение атрибута NAME объекта checkbox.
Объект checkbox в форме выглядет следующим образом:
Объект checkbox - элемент формы и должен быть определен внутри тега HTML <FORM>.
Свойства и методы флажков имеют множество применений.
Используйте свойство checked объект checkbox для проверки текущего состояния флажка: установлен(true) или нет(false). Если атрибут CHECKED был использован в определении флажка, свойство defaultChecked также возращает true.
Пример 1. Следующий пример показывает группу четырех checkbox, которые все отмеченны по умолчанию.
R&B
Jazz
Blues
Newage
Пример 2. Следующий пример содержит форму с тремя текстовыми блоками и одним checkbox. Checkbox позволяет пользователя выбрать, преобразовывать или нет текс в большие буквы. Каждая текстовая область имеет обработчик событий onChange , который преобразует значение области , если флажок выбран. Checkbox имеет обработчика событий onClick, который преобразовывает области, когда пользователь выбирает checkbox.
Логическое значение, представляющее текущее состояние отдельного флажка или переключателя.
1. CheckboxName.checked 2. RadioName [index] .checked
CheckboxName является либо значением атрибута NAME объекта checkbox или элемента в массиве elements.
RadioName - значение атрибута NAME объекта radio.
index - целое число, представляющее переключатели в объекте radio.
Если флажок или переключатель выбраны, то значение выбранного свойства истинна; иначе ложно.
Вы можете управлять свойством в любое время. Флажок или переключатель модернизируется немедленно, после таго как вы исправили свойство.
Следующий пример исследует массив переключателей musicType в форме musicForm, чтобы определить, кокая выбрана кнопка. Будуче использовано в цикле for...in, свойство может определить состояние кнопок:
Отключает таймер, установленный при помощи метода setTimeout.
ClearTimeout (timeoutID)
TimeoutID - отключает таймер, который был установлен предыдущим запросом методом setTimeout.
Смотрите описание для метода setTimeout.
Смотрите примеры для метода setTimeout.
Эмулирует щелчок на объекте левой кнопкой мыши.
1. ButtonName.click () 2. RadioName [index] .click ()
3. CheckboxName.click ()
ButtonName является либо значением атрибута NAME кнопки reset либо объект submit либо элемент в массиве elements.
RadioName - значение атрибута NAME объекта radio либо элемент в массиве elements.
index - целое число, представляющее переключатель в объекте radio.
CheckboxName является либо значением атрибута NAME объекта checkbox либо элемент в массиве elements.
button, checkbox, radio, reset, submit
Эффект щелчка зависит от типа элемента формы.
Воздействие метода click на элементы формы:
Следующий пример переключает состояние выбора первого переключателя в musicType объекте radio в форме musicForm:
Document.musicForm.musicType [0] .click ()
Следующий пример переключает состояние выбора переключателя newAge в форме musicForm:
Document.musicForm.newAge.click ()
Для документов закрывает текущий поток вывода и показывает содержимое документа на экране.
Document.close ()
Для документов метод close прекращает динамическое формирование документа, выводит содержимое документа на экран и сообщение в строке состояния "Document:Done".
") msgWindow.document.close() }
Закрывает указанное окно.
WindowReference.close ()
WindowReference - способ имеющий силу только для окна, смотрите в объекте window.
Метод close закрывает указанное окно. Если Вы вызываете close без определения windowReference, JavaScript закрывает текущее окно.
В обработчиках событий, вы должны определять window.close () вместо использования close().
Любой из следующих примеров закрывает текущее окно:
Window.close ()
self.close ()
close()
Следующий пример закрывает окно messageWin:
MessageWin.close ()
Теперь создадим пример, который открывает новое окно. Загрузим туда web-страницу, где при нажатие кнопки оно будет закрыто:
Показывает диалоговое окно
Значение строки cookie, которая содержит небольшое количество информации, сохраненной Navigator в файле cookies.txt.
Document.cookie
Значение, хранимое в свойстве cookie, может быть извлечено с помощью методов charAt, indexOf, и lastIndexOf.
Вы можете управлять свойством cookie в любое время.
Следующая функция использует свойством cookie, чтобы делать запись напоминания для пользователей заявления(применения). " Истекает = " компонента, устанавливает дату истечения срока для печенья, так что это сохраняется вне текущего сеанса окна просмотра. Формат даты должен быть
Wdy, DD-Mon-YY HH:MM:SS GMTГде Wednesday - имя дня недели, DD - днь месяца, Mon - месяц, YY - последние два числа года, и HH, MM, и SS - соответственно часы, минуты, и секунды.
Это тот же формат даты какой возвращяет Date.toGMTString, за исключением:
Например, имеет силу истечения даты cookies:
expires=Wednesday, 09-Nov-99 23:12:40 GMT
Когда пользователь грузит страницу, которая содержит эту функцию, другая функция использует indexOf ("@") и indexOf ("=") чтобы определить дату и время, сохраненную в печеньи.
Возвращает косинус своего аргумента.
Math.cos (number)
number - числовое выражение, представляющее размер угла в радианах.
Метод cos возвращает числовое значение в диапозоне между -1 и 1.
// Показывает значение 6.123031769111886e-017 document.write (" косинус PI/2 радиан, " + Math.cos (Math. PI/2)) // Показывает значение -1 document.write (" косинус PI радиан " + Math.cos (Math. PI)) // Показывает значение 1 document.write (" косинус 0 радиан - " + Math.cos (0))